About Duty Rates: Rates are divided into Column 1 and Column 2. Column 1 is subdivided into General (normal trade relations rates for all countries not eligible for special programs) and Special (preferential rates for countries with free trade agreements or preference programs). Column 2 rates apply to products from Cuba, North Korea, Belarus, and Russia. When no special rate exists for a classification, General rates apply.

Overview

This HTS subcategory, 5602.90.60.00, specifically classifies felt, whether or not impregnated, coated, covered, or laminated, that is *other* than those made from other materials and is composed *of man-made fibers*. This designation captures a wide range of felted materials where the primary constituent fibers are synthetic, such as polyester, nylon, acrylic, or rayon. These materials are produced by entangling fibers, rather than weaving or knitting, and are then consolidated through mechanical, thermal, or chemical processes.

The key distinction for this classification lies in its material composition. While the parent category 5602.90 covers "Other" felt not meeting the definitions of specific types, this subcategory narrows the scope to felt made exclusively from man-made fibers. This differentiates it from sibling categories that might encompass felt made from natural fibers or blends where natural fibers are predominant.

As a leaf node, 5602.90.60.00 has no further subdivisions. Therefore, the focus for classification at this level is on verifying that the felt meets the general description of felt and is indeed composed of man-made fibers. Examples of goods falling under this classification could include certain types of industrial felt used for filtration, sound dampening, or insulation, provided they are made from synthetic fibers.
